Abstract

With the rise of artificial intelligence, humanoid robots have entered people's lives. It integrates many disciplines such as machine, electricity, materials, computers, sensors, control technology and so on, attracting researchers to study continuously. At present, there are also many national robot competitions in China that take humanoid robots as the competition items. Based on the existing competition rules, we have studied some problems in the design of humanoid robots. Through software modeling, entity building and practical experiments, we have proposed some design optimization schemes for the degree of freedom of both arms, robot stability, environment perception and program logic.
